引言

在数字化时代,数据处理已成为各行各业不可或缺的一部分。字节,作为数据的基本存储单位,理解其计算奥秘对于高效处理数据至关重要。本文将深入解析字节计算的基本概念,并提供在线学习资源,帮助读者轻松掌握数据处理技巧。

字节计算基础

什么是字节?

字节(Byte)是计算机存储信息的基本单位,通常表示为8位(bits)。每个位只能表示0或1,因此一个字节可以表示256种不同的值。

字节与位的关系

1字节 = 8位 这意味着,8个二进制位可以组合成一个字节。

字节计算公式

  • 字节 = 位 / 8
  • 位 = 字节 * 8

数据类型与字节

常见数据类型及其字节大小

  • 整数(int):4字节
  • 单精度浮点数(float):4字节
  • 双精度浮点数(double):8字节
  • 字符串(String):根据字符编码,如UTF-8,每个字符可能占用1到4字节

数据类型大小的影响

数据类型的大小直接影响到内存的使用。了解不同数据类型的大小有助于优化程序性能和内存管理。

在线学习资源

教程网站

  • Codecademy:提供编程基础教程,包括数据处理。
  • Coursera:合作大学提供的在线课程,涵盖数据科学和编程。

视频教程

  • YouTube:搜索“数据处理教程”或“字节计算入门”等关键词,可以找到大量免费教程。
  • Udemy:提供付费和免费的视频课程,包括数据处理专题。

书籍推荐

  • 《Python编程:从入门到实践》
  • 《数据科学入门:使用Python进行数据挖掘和分析》

实践操作

编程示例

以下是一个Python示例,演示如何计算字符串的字节数:

# Python 示例:计算字符串的字节数
text = "Hello, World!"
byte_count = len(text.encode('utf-8'))
print(f"The string '{text}' has {byte_count} bytes.")

在线工具

总结

字节是数据处理的基础,理解字节计算对于提高数据处理效率至关重要。通过在线资源和实践操作,您可以轻松掌握数据处理技巧。希望本文能帮助您在数据科学和编程领域取得进步。